Braised Chuck Roast With Red Wine. Chuck roast is marinated overnight and then braised (brasato) in a hearty red wine, resulting in flavorful, succulent meat. As the braising process unfolds, the chuck roast. The chuck roast is then braised low and slow in a symphony of red wine, beef stock, aromatic herbs, vegetables and potatoes. Don't forget to buy two bottles of wine so you can enjoy one with the meal! This is a traditional dish from northern italy that's typically served on sundays.
